Sports betting in the last decade has become both more accessible and more complicated than ever. Between changing regulations, a flood of new platforms, and the incredible rise of crypto-based wagering, the landscape looks almost nothing like it did just ten years ago. For the casual fan who just wants to bet a few dollars on the weekend game, keeping up with all of it can feel like a full-time job.

The Regulatory Maze Is Getting Messier

One of the biggest misconceptions about online betting in 2026 is that it’s been “sorted out”, but that is far from the truth. In the US alone, the legal picture varies wildly from state to state. Some have fully regulated, taxed, and licensed markets. Others still operate in grey zones. A few have gone backward. Meanwhile, Canada, Australia, and parts of Europe are all mid-revision on their own frameworks.

In practice, this means that a platform that’s perfectly legal for your friend in one state may be off-limits to you entirely, or accessible through a workaround that carries real risk. Before you put money anywhere, it’s worth checking whether that platform actually holds a license in your jurisdiction, not just a license somewhere.

This fragmentation is actually one of the reasons crypto betting has grown so fast. It sidesteps a lot of the geographic restrictions that licensed sportsbooks have to enforce.

Crypto Changed the Game — But Not How Everyone Expected

When Bitcoin betting first became a thing, the assumption was that it was mostly for tech enthusiasts and people trying to dodge oversight. That’s not really the picture anymore. Crypto sportsbooks now attract mainstream bettors for entirely mundane reasons, like faster withdrawals, lower fees, and less hassle about deposits.

Even more interestingly is the growth of platforms that don’t require the standard identity verification process. In short, some platforms accept crypto, ask for minimal personal information, and let you start betting or gambling almost immediately. For bettors in regions with restrictive laws, or simply those who’d rather not hand over their passport scan to a gambling site, the appeal is obvious.

Whether that trade-off is right for you depends on what you’re prioritizing. Convenience and privacy come with less consumer protection if something goes wrong, and that is a risk you must judge for yourself.

The Sportsbook-Casino Crossover Is Now the Norm

Not so long ago, there was a clear divide between sportsbooks and casinos. That line has almost completely dissolved. Most major platforms now offer both under one roof, with shared wallets, combined bonuses, and seamless switching between betting on a match and spinning a few slots in the halftime break.

This convergence is good for convenience but worth approaching with awareness. The impulses that make you back your team to win is not the same as what drives casino play. Casinos are engineered differently, with faster feedback loops and fewer natural stopping points. If you’re primarily a sports bettor, it’s easy to wander into casino territory and find the habits don’t quite transfer.

Bonuses Are More Complicated Than They Look

Welcome bonuses have always been a fixture of online betting, but in 2026 the offers have gotten more elaborate. At the same time, the terms have become less transparent. Matched deposits, free bet credits, wagering requirements, and withdrawal locks are all standard parts of the small print now.

The basic rule: if a bonus looks too generous, dig into the wagering requirements before you get excited. A 200% deposit match that requires you to wager 40x the bonus amount before withdrawing is not really a gift. It’s a mechanism to keep your money on the platform longer.
